What it is, and what it is for

Pandora is a large format RepStrap with a build volume of approximately 450 x 850 x 900mm. It is built of aluminium V-slot extrusion, with CoreXY gantry geometry at the top face, and a bed that lowers away from the extruder on leadscrews.

Its purpose is to print body parts for velomobiles (streamlined bicycles) and perhaps other light but bulky structures.

Problems encountered

Homing such a large bed is problematic. Any missed steps on one motor will cause it to go out of level. Unfortunately the Rambo doesn't support independent leveling (where each side has its own endstop). I'm building a counterweight for both sides, which will ease some of the friction in the nut blocks. From here, the next step is to connect the Z motors in series rather than Rambo's default parallel (to get more current into them) and/or to replace them with Nema23's.
